Why Tree Removal Costs Vary

No two tree removals are exactly alike.

A small ornamental tree in an open yard requires far less time and equipment than a 90-foot oak hanging over a home or power lines.

Professional tree services evaluate several factors before providing an estimate to ensure the work is completed safely and efficiently.


1. Tree Size and Height

One of the biggest factors affecting cost is the size of the tree.

Generally:

  • Small trees require less labor and equipment.
  • Medium-sized trees take longer to dismantle safely.
  • Large mature trees often require specialized equipment and experienced crews.

Larger trees not only take more time to remove but also produce significantly more debris that must be hauled away.


2. Tree Location

Where the tree is located can dramatically affect removal costs.

Trees growing in open areas are usually easier to remove than trees located near:

  • Homes
  • Garages
  • Fences
  • Swimming pools
  • Power lines
  • Driveways
  • Neighboring properties

When working in tight spaces, crews often use advanced rigging techniques to safely lower branches and trunk sections without damaging surrounding structures.


3. Tree Condition

The health of the tree also plays an important role.

Trees that are:

  • Dead
  • Diseased
  • Storm-damaged
  • Leaning
  • Hollow

may require additional safety precautions during removal.

For example, a dead tree can become brittle and unpredictable, making it more dangerous to climb and dismantle.


4. Accessibility

Easy access means faster, more efficient work.

However, if crews cannot get equipment close to the tree, additional labor may be required.

Limited access situations include:

  • Narrow backyards
  • Steep hillsides
  • Fenced properties
  • Wet or soft ground
  • Landscaped gardens

The more difficult the access, the longer the project may take.


5. Emergency Tree Removal

Storms can create dangerous situations that require immediate attention.

Emergency services often involve:

  • Downed trees blocking driveways
  • Trees resting on homes
  • Broken limbs hanging overhead
  • Trees threatening power lines

Emergency response requires specialized equipment, additional crew members, and quick mobilization, which may affect overall pricing.


6. Stump Grinding and Cleanup

Tree removal and stump removal are often separate services.

After a tree is removed, homeowners can choose to leave the stump or have it professionally ground below ground level.

Benefits of stump grinding include:

  • Improved curb appeal
  • Elimination of tripping hazards
  • Prevention of insect infestations
  • Easier lawn maintenance
  • Space for future landscaping

Many homeowners choose to complete both services at the same time for convenience.

How Preventive Tree Care Can Save You Money

Many costly tree removals can be avoided with regular maintenance.

Routine tree care helps identify problems early and can:

  • Remove hazardous branches before they fail
  • Improve tree structure
  • Detect disease in its early stages
  • Reduce storm damage
  • Extend the life of healthy trees

Investing in preventive care today may help you avoid expensive emergency removals tomorrow.

Does homeowners insurance cover tree removal?

Insurance may cover tree removal if a tree falls due to a covered event—such as a storm—and damages a home or other insured structure. Coverage varies by policy, so it’s best to check with your insurance provider.
